A man has appeared before Blackburn magistrates charged in connection an attempted robbery at McDonald's in Accrington on Wednesday.

John Carroll, 40, of Dowry Street, Accrington, was charged with attempting to rob McDonald’s employee Matthew Taylor of cash, possessing an offensive weapon, a hammer, and possessing a bladed instrument, a Stanley knife, in McDonald's.

He was remanded in custody to appear before the crown court on March 14.

Two workmen were praised by police after the alleged incident for stopping the suspect and waving down a passing patrol car.
